Embodiment 1~3、5

[0121] (Preparation method) The component (B) was put into the container for 2 L vacuum emulsifiers, and it heated to 85 degreeC. After confirming that the component (B) was dissolved, the components (A), (C), and (D) were added and stirred at 80 rpm. Next, the water phase containing the component (E) heated to 85 degreeC was added, and it stirred at 8000 rpm at high speed for 10 minutes under reduced pressure, and emulsified. Thereafter, it was cooled to room temperature at a cooling rate of 1.0° C. / min while stirring at 100 rpm under reduced pressure.

Abstract

A water-in-oil emulsified cosmetic including components (A) to (E) below: (A) an oil that is a liquid at 25°C, (B) an oil that is a solid at 25°C, (C) a hydrophobic powder having an average particle size of 8 to 30 µm, (D) a surfactant having an HLB of no greater than 8, and (E) water, component (A) having a content of 10 to 50 wt%, component (B) having a content of 0.5 to 15 wt%, component (C) having a content of 0.5 to 10 wt%, and component (D) having a content of 0.2 to 10 wt%, the proportions by weight ratio of components (A) to (E) satisfying the relational expressions (1) to (3) below, E : A + B + C = 10 : 90 to 70 : 30 0.25 ‰¤ B + C / A ‰¤ 0.7 B > C 3 , emulsified particles, emulsified from an aqueous phase component containing component (E), having an average emulsified particle size of 0.1 to 25 µm, the relationship in size of the average emulsified particle size, average particle size of component (B), and average particle size of component (C) being (average particle size of component (C)) > (average particle size of component (B)) > (average emulsified particle size), and the cosmetic having a viscosity measured at 25°C and 5 rpm using a T-bar spindle D of 500 to 3,000 dPa·s.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a water-in-oil emulsified cosmetic. Background technique [0002] Cosmetics are provided in the form of cream emulsions that combine water, water-soluble oils as various moisturizers, and oils to replenish moisture and oil to the skin. The user's sense of the effect of cosmetics is not only obtained by the ingredients in the composition, but also varies according to the various physical properties of the cosmetic emulsion. For example, the luster of the cosmetic emulsion, the smoothness when applied, the affinity with the skin and other properties. [0003] On the other hand, researchers have studied how to change the feeling of use when applying cosmetics by adding various powders to cosmetics. Specifically, by coating the spherical powder on the skin surface, the tactility of the sphere itself improves the softness of the cosmetics, the goodness of affinity, and the absence of stickiness or smoothness.
